Output ebfc6c691749d96abede61c813e0b1f49c8a4f13257e2cd52aa7eac5da5ea2da:1

value
2798210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32cbcf48d307b1b354302ce2134f2c84c093aacd OP_EQUAL
address
36Kbs5hYNHtajwPV8USvtiK7H6SVoHcgUT
transaction
ebfc6c691749d96abede61c813e0b1f49c8a4f13257e2cd52aa7eac5da5ea2da
confirmations
185872
spent
true